Stairs Handrail- Finally!!!

 I completed the handrail like I did the stairs but it took a lot less time. I first, hand sanded the rail with 120 sandpaper then moved to a finer paper (did not take longer then a hour). After cleaning the rail, I applied the stain. After two coats, I applied two coats of polyurethane. (Make sure you follow the directions on your stain and polyurethane for dry time) Here is a picture of the stain and polyurethane I used for both stairs and handrail.
After everything had dried it was time to put the rail back into place.
 I first added the hardware (I do not know what they are called) by screwing in the screws just a little bit.
 Then I placed the rail were it should go, and finished screwing the screws in.
